I have no idea what you mean by "blank file blocking viewing primary media" Legacy will use a place holder image of a Question mark when it cannot find an image file in the location it is expecting the file, is that what you meant by a blank file? It also uses place holder images to represent media which are not image files such as Documents, Sounds and Videos. Legacy 8 includes a much improved Media Re-linker which will search your entire computer for missing files. If it finds only one copy it will automatically revise the file link to point to that found file. If it finds multiple files with the same name it will let you choose which file location is the correct version of the file.
